2017-07-27 78 views
0
在單元格編輯

jqxgrid handlekeyboardnavigation事件並單擊標籤 移動到下一個可編輯cell..But它應該進入下一列單元格..jqxgrid handlekeyboardnavigation事件並單擊標籤

嘗試下面撥弄

開始編輯Last Name列並按Tab。它將輸入Ship Date編輯器,但Product單元得到了jqx-grid-cell-selected class。 有沒有任何解決辦法可以防止它發生?任何方式使網格導航只能在可編輯列中使用? 在此先感謝!

JS FIDDLE

+0

嗨@約翰想檢查http://www.jqwidgets.com/jquery-widgets-demo/demos/jqxgrid/cellediting.htm –

+0

HTTP://www.jqwidgets。 com/jquery-widgets-demo/demos/jqxgrid/index.htm#demos/jqxgrid/cellediting.htm –

+0

這些鏈接無法回答我的情況。這是從可編輯的字段(單元格)到不可編輯的字段(單元格),如果您選中它,則會移動到網格中的其他可編輯字段(單元格)而不是下一列。 –

回答

0

你必須使產品可編輯的列。

{ 
    text: 'Product', 
    datafield: 'productname', 
    width: 177, 
    //editable: false, 
    cellbeginedit: beginedit, 
    cellsrenderer: cellsrenderer 
}, 

http://jsfiddle.net/waqas61/7jb1dn4c/

+0

從'姓氏'選項卡轉到'發運日期列'而不是轉到'產品'列 –

+0

請在http://jsfiddle.net/waqas61/o1L7thvd/ –

+0

檢查它請清楚地閱讀問題。您將'產品'字段設置爲可編輯並顯示在小提琴中。我的問題是如何選擇「不可編輯」字段?我希望'產品'字段位於'不可編輯'字段。 –